Metastatic breast cancer treatment can be difficult for most families to afford. It can be particularly difficult for people from underserved communities, who may have more financial obstacles.
In this video, learn tips to help you afford your metastatic breast cancer treatment, according to Monique Gary, DO, FACS, Breast Surgical Oncologist in Greater Philadelphia.
